- Joint Oireachtas Committee on Foreign Affairs and Trade: Irish Prisoners Abroad: Ibrahim Halawa (29 Apr 2015)
Pat Breen: Most members have been presented with an update from the Department on the case of Ibrahim Halawa. The case was heard on Sunday, 26 April and bail was refused for all the applications. Part of the reason it was adjourned was that some of the lawyers for the defendants were looking for additional time to prepare more information on the cases. The good news we are hearing is that Ibrahim...
